What Fix actually is
Fix is a fixed-term supply tariff with options for electricity and gas. Rates are set for the contract period, so you’re not as exposed to short-term market mood swings as on a variable product.
It’s for people who value predictability over constantly hunting the next cheap switch.
What’s in the box
In plain terms, Fix typically means:
- 100% renewable-matched electricity from British generation
- Greener gas (~10% biogas + Gold Standard offset) on gas versions
- Smart meter only
- Fixed pricing for the term
Yes, you’ll need a smart meter
Fix is smart meter only. If you don’t have one, that’s part of the journey. The upside: a smart meter also unlocks EV and Heat Pump tariffs later if your home changes.

Claim £50 credit →When I’d choose Fix
I’d lean Fix if you:
- Want a known rate for budgeting
- Already have — or will accept — a smart meter
- Care about renewable matching, not only the cheapest weekly teaser rate
- Don’t yet need EV or heat-pump time-of-use structure
If you drive electric or heat with a pump, compare Fix against those specialist tariffs before you lock in.

FAQs
Can I take electricity-only Fix?
Usually yes — Fix has options for electricity and gas, so you can often choose electricity only.
Are there exit fees?
Fixed deals often charge if you leave early. Check the Tariff Information Label for the version you’re considering.
Is Fix always cheaper than Standard Variable?
No. Fix buys certainty. Sometimes that costs a little; sometimes it saves you. It depends when you lock in.
